Kinds of Treadmills
When thinking about a treadmill for home use, it is important to understand the various types readily available on the marketplace. The following table summarizes the most typical kinds of home treadmills:
Type of Treadmill | Functions | Suitable For |
---|---|---|
Handbook Treadmills | No motors, user-powered | Budget-conscious users |
Motorized Treadmills | Includes a motor for speed and incline settings | Versatile workouts |
Folding Treadmills | Can be folded for simple storage | Limited area |
Desk Treadmills | Enables walking while working | Multi-taskers |
Smart Treadmills | Geared up with interactive features and connectivity | Tech-savvy users |

Keeping Your At Home Treadmill
Appropriate maintenance is essential for making sure the longevity and efficiency of a treadmill. Here are some necessary suggestions for keeping your devices in top shape:
- Regular Cleaning: Wipe down the treadmill after each usage to eliminate sweat and dirt. Utilize a soft, damp cloth and moderate detergent.
- Lubrication: Check the producer's guidelines relating to lubrication of the treadmill belt. Frequently oil the belt to avoid wear and tear.
- Examine the Tension: Ensure the belt is appropriately tensioned; a loose belt can slip or misalign.
- Examine Components: Regularly examine for any loose screws or worn components. Resolve any problems promptly to avoid additional damage.
- Software Updates: For wise treadmills, make sure that the software is updated to take full advantage of functions and enhance performance.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: Can I utilize a manual treadmill for heavy workouts?
A1: Manual treadmills are generally designed for lighter, more casual workouts and may not stand up to extreme or regular usage like motorized treadmills do.
Q2: How much space do I need for a treadmill?
A2: Ideally, you need to designate a space of a minimum of 6 feet long by 3 feet wide for a treadmill, permitting sufficient room to move safely.
Q3: Is walking on a treadmill as reliable as running?
A3: Walking on a treadmill can still offer significant cardiovascular advantages and may be more suitable for those with joint concerns or novices. However, running usually burns more calories in a much shorter amount of time.
Q4: How frequently should I service my treadmill?
A4: Routine cleansing and maintenance must be done every few months, while expert maintenance might be required each year, depending upon usage.
Q5: Can I do strength training workouts on a treadmill?
A5: While treadmills are mainly created for cardiovascular workouts, users can integrate body-weight workouts, such as lunges or planks, before or after their treadmill sessions for a complete exercise.
